A 42 associate brought a gun to a city bar during a meeting with rivals Parkside, then pulled the trigger at them on Reid Street, a prosecutor alleged today.
Alvone Maybury, 24, is said to be part of a group from 42 who met Parkside for a discussion at Captain’s Lounge in Hamilton, on the night of December 18, 2009.
According to prosecutor Carrington Mahoney’s opening speech in his Supreme Court trial, Maybury fired a shot in the direction of the opposing group before fleeing in a car. Maybury denies possessing a gun and ammunition and discharging a shot from a gun.
